This sycamore tree is called a "Potomac sycamore" because of its proximity to the Potomac River regardless of the fact that the river is 20 miles away.
But this sycamore has been identified to be over 200 years old. The "old National Road" runs to its right and up the hill. Power lines and phone cables led to much of the right side being "trimmed" out. But it is gigantic! 125ft tall years ago.
